Our client, a US based bank, is looking for a direct hire in their Risk & Compliance department. Work is remote with occasional overnight travel to the corporate headquarters.
Responsibilities -
- Oversee the bank’s policy and procedure management system/module, ensuring it functions optimally and meets organizational needs.
- Administer, configure, and customize the policy management system to align with the bank’s internal workflows and regulatory requirements.
- Ensure that the system is user-friendly and provides stakeholders with easy access to the most current versions of policies and procedures.
- Manage the lifecycle of all policies and procedures, ensuring accurate version control and proper documentation of updates.
- Implement structured workflows for the creation, review, approval, and distribution of policies and procedures across departments.
- Ensure policies and procedures are properly stored, with an audit trail for all revisions, and remain compliant with regulatory requirements.
- Monitor industry regulations and internal needs to ensure policies and procedures are regularly updated and compliant with relevant laws.
- Collaborate with subject matter experts (SMEs) and department heads to draft, revise, and finalize policies and procedures in line with business objectives.
- Coordinate and facilitate the periodic review process to ensure all policies are reviewed on schedule.
- Provide training and support to bank employees on how to navigate and utilize the policy and procedure management system.
- Develop training materials, guides, and resources to assist employees in understanding new or updated policies and procedures.
- Address user inquiries and issues related to the system, ensuring resolution in a timely and effective manner.
- Generate reports on the status of policies and procedures, including review timelines, approval workflows, and the completion of updates.
- Track compliance with internal policy review cycles, identifying bottlenecks and recommending process improvements.
- Provide regular management reports on the effectiveness of the policy management system, highlighting trends, risks, and areas for improvement.
- Ensure that all policies and procedures are documented and managed in compliance with banking regulations, industry standards, and internal control requirements.
- Support internal and external audits by providing accurate and complete policy records and assisting in audit preparation.
- Maintain compliance with applicable laws, regulations, and audit standards, ensuring the policy and procedure management system is audit-ready at all times.
- Continuously evaluate the policy and procedure management process to identify opportunities for improvement and automation.
- Work closely with IT teams and external vendors to implement system enhancements, ensuring the platform remains aligned with evolving organizational needs.
- Research industry best practices for policy management and apply relevant improvements to the bank’s system and processes.
